Timetable for Father Mathew Feis

Schedule for the Father Mather Feis, Church Street. The timetable outlines the various competitions and the list of plays and groups participating in the National Drama Festival of Ireland. The premier award was the Capuchin Periodicals Cup, presented by Fr. Senan Moynihan OFM Cap. (‘won in 1953 by The Walkinstown Players’). The F.J. McCormack Cup and Gold Medal, designed by Richard King, was awarded for best character acting.

Feis Associate Membership Form

Membership form for the Associate Members’ Guild of the Father Mathew Feis. Invitations are to be sent to Fr. Nessan Shaw OFM Cap., President, Father Mathew Hall.

Feis Programme

Programme for the Father Mathew Feis, Church Street, 1983. The programme lists the various bursaries offered for certain competitions at the Feis and provides a list of committee members and adjudicators. The rules of the Feis are set out. The competitions include: singing; piano; string competitions; accordion; speech and drama; 'Aithriseóireacht'.

The John McCormack Cup

Inscribed on the bowl: ‘John McCormack Cup’. On reverse of the bowl: ‘Presented to the Feis Maitiú on behalf of the John McCormack Society of Ireland on 19/4/1994 by Mr. Liam Breen Hon. President’. The base is engraved with the winners in 1995 and in 1997.

The Carlow Bowl

Inscribed on the bowl: ‘The Carlow Bowl. Feis Maitiú. 1977’. The base includes silver shields indicating winners from 1977-95.

Tynan Pianos Perpetual Cup

Inscribed on the bowl: ‘Tynan Pianos Perpetual Cup. Feis Maitiú’. The base includes an inscription denoting the winners from 1993-95’.
